Abstract: The importance of a business continuity and disaster recovery plan to an organization cannot be over-emphasized. Business continuity in an organization serve as a lifeline to organizations when a disaster event occurs. This study emphasizes on the need for an effective business continuity and disaster recovery plan in higher education institutions by evaluating universities in north Cyprus’ disaster recovery mechanism. Deming circle approach was used in evaluation with questions asked to respondents based on the four different stages of the Deming circle.
